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Kustomize

  • No packaging or distribution story, which is exactly what Helm charts provide
  • Deeply nested overlays become hard to follow, and reasoning about the final output requires building it
  • No release lifecycle: nothing tracks what is installed or supports rollback the way Helm does
  • Patch syntax is fiddly for anything beyond simple field replacement

Notion

  • Free plan limited to 1,000 blocks for 2+ member workspaces, restricting team usage
  • Free tier only includes trial AI capabilities; full Notion AI requires paid plan
  • Page history limited to 7 days on free plan
  • Per-member pricing increases costs for teams compared to flat-rate competitors
  • Limited automation capabilities compared to dedicated workflow platforms

Kustomize: Kustomize or Helm?

Kustomize patches plain YAML and keeps bases readable; Helm templates and packages applications with a release lifecycle. Many teams use both — Helm to install third-party charts, Kustomize to patch them.

Kustomize: Do I need to install Kustomize?

No. It is built into kubectl, available through kubectl apply -k.
